On Thu, Jan 13, 2011 at 12:47:34PM +0100, Matthias Bolte wrote:
> 2011/1/13 Richard W.M. Jones <rjones at redhat.com>:
> > It's probably impossible from the ESX driver itself, but you could run
> > virt-inspector on the domain and translate the result into a suitable
> > guestOS string. virt-inspector supports a large proportion of the
> > OSes listed.
>
> That won't work in general, as you want to set the guest OS type in
> the VMX config before you install the guest OS.
So you're stuck with modelling it in the libvirt XML somehow.
I will just add that a current RFE is to make virt-inspector work on
install CDs. The idea is in virt-manager that we have it
automatically fill in the OS hints based on the ISO you try to use.
For more information see:
http://libguestfs.org/TODO.txt # section "live CD inspection"
